Storms Trigger Flight Delays at Chicago O’Hare

Thunderstorms Slow Operations Across One of the Busiest Hubs

Publicly available data from the Federal Aviation Administration on Sunday afternoon indicated a ground delay program in effect at Chicago O’Hare, with average arrival delays of close to an hour as storms moved through the region. Thunderstorms in and around the airport reduced the number of aircraft that could safely land and depart each hour, forcing air traffic managers to meter arrivals and departures.

Real-time tracking services showed a growing list of delayed departures and extended arrival times into O’Hare through the afternoon. Some flights from nearby Midwest cities were held on the ground, while inbound aircraft from farther afield were assigned holding patterns or reduced speeds to limit congestion in the skies above northern Illinois.

The unsettled conditions followed a period of early summer heat and humidity in the Chicago area, which forecasters warned would provide fuel for strong to potentially severe thunderstorms. By midafternoon, radar imagery showed storms pushing across the metro area and into the western Great Lakes, lining up directly with some of O’Hare’s busiest arrival and departure corridors.

Weather observers reported overcast skies, gusty northeast winds and scattered heavy downpours in the vicinity of the airport. Even when lightning and the heaviest rain temporarily moved away, lingering cells and low cloud ceilings kept the airspace constrained and limited the pace at which operations could recover.

Passengers Face Long Waits and Missed Connections

The delays rippled quickly through terminal operations, leaving many passengers facing extended waits at gates and a heightened risk of missed connections. Same-day trip planners, particularly those traveling through O’Hare on tight layovers, encountered revised departure times stretching an hour or more beyond the original schedule.

Accounts shared on travel forums and social media on Sunday described crowded gate areas, frequent updates on departure boards and long lines at customer service desks as travelers attempted to rebook missed connections or secure alternate routings. Some travelers reported receiving late-morning and early-afternoon alerts from airlines warning of potential disruptions and encouraging the use of mobile tools to monitor flights.

O’Hare functions as a major connecting hub for both domestic and international traffic, so a slowdown in operations can quickly cascade beyond the Chicago region. When storms limit takeoff and landing capacity, aircraft and crews arriving late to O’Hare often depart late on their next legs, pushing delays deeper into the evening schedule across multiple cities.

For some passengers, the weather-related delays added to a pattern of recent disruptions tied to spring and early summer storms in the Midwest. Earlier episodes this season have produced similar slowdowns around Chicago and other large hubs, illustrating how quickly convective weather can overwhelm even robust schedule buffers.

Storm Risk Aligned With Broader Severe Weather Outlook

The storms affecting O’Hare on Sunday formed within a broader environment of elevated severe weather risk across the Chicago area. Forecast discussions and outlooks issued overnight highlighted the potential for strong to severe thunderstorms, with damaging wind gusts, hail and frequent lightning possible as temperatures climbed into the upper 70s and 80s Fahrenheit.

Weather outlooks covering northern Illinois placed much of the metropolitan region under a slight risk category for severe thunderstorms, signaling that scattered intense cells were expected. That level of risk is often enough to prompt aviation planners to build in additional margins around key traffic flows, particularly during peak travel periods.

In the case of O’Hare, the timing of the storms coincided with a busy Sunday travel window, when weekend visitors, business travelers and connecting passengers all converge. The combination of high traffic volume and convective weather tends to magnify the operational impact, as there are fewer open gates and limited slack in the system to absorb schedule changes.

National aviation statistics and seasonal summaries consistently show that thunderstorms are among the leading weather-related causes of delays in the United States, with large hub airports such as O’Hare especially vulnerable. The challenge is not only the rain and turbulence inside a storm cell, but also the lightning risk to ground crews and the need to maintain increased separation between aircraft in congested airspace.

Outlook for the Remainder of the Day

Forecasts for Sunday evening indicated that additional scattered thunderstorms could develop or linger near the Chicago area, suggesting that delays at O’Hare might persist into the later hours. The degree of improvement will depend on how quickly storms clear departure and arrival paths and whether new cells form along the same corridors.

As operations recover, air traffic managers typically increase the rate of arrivals and departures in stages, seeking to balance safety with the need to clear backlogs of waiting aircraft. That process can produce periods of gradual improvement punctuated by renewed slowdowns if another storm cell moves into the area.

Given O’Hare’s role as a national and international hub, travelers across the United States and abroad may continue to feel knock-on effects from Sunday’s storms, even if they are not flying directly through Chicago. Airlines often need several schedule cycles to fully reposition aircraft and crews after a weather event of this scale.
